Which statement is true about acid production by health-associated streptococci?

Explanation:
Acid production by health-associated streptococci comes from fermenting carbohydrates to acids like lactic acid, which lowers the plaque pH. But these streptococci are relatively acid-sensitive; their metabolism can be inhibited when the environment becomes too acidic. The typical threshold where metabolic activity declines is around pH 6. This means they generate acid when conditions are near neutral, but as the pH drops toward 6, their enzymes and cellular processes are inhibited, limiting further metabolism. That’s why the statement that they stop metabolism around pH 6 due to acid sensitivity is the best choice. In contrast, stopping at neutral pH 7 isn’t characteristic, stopping only at very acidic pH around 5 would imply greater acid tolerance than these health-associated strains have, and saying they never stop ignores the clear effect of acid on their metabolism.
